Output eabe50caa17d67fb70fc2b75f1ddc95a84d436018e9478b024cab20e1813ae81:3

value
23304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2f0f662d5e517910892c0c1570ad270f9b71d60 OP_EQUAL
address
3KTmg86KuzyDewXpAnYHkuFyjG1dAdXfXs
transaction
eabe50caa17d67fb70fc2b75f1ddc95a84d436018e9478b024cab20e1813ae81
spent
true